Hello,

A classmate of mine has recently purchased a motherboard with an nVidia
MCP61 chipset. Because the chipset isn't listed in the FreeBSD ATA code
yet, all his disks use UDMA33. We performed some tests and the following
patch causes his ATA controller to run at UDMA133 and his harddisks at
SATA300.

	http://g-rave.nl/junk/freebsd-ata-mcp61.diff

Could this patch be integrated with FreeBSD CURRENT? If so: could it be
MFC'd as well?
